​Understanding Roof Leak Damage in Florida

​
​Florida's hurricane season brings about not only the threat of immediate wind damage but also the prolonged peril of water intrusion through roof leaks. The subtropical climate fosters conditions ripe for severe weather events that can test the integrity of even the best-constructed homes. Understanding the common causes of roof leaks in this region, which range from aging materials to flawed installations or storm damage, is crucial for homeowners. This knowledge not only assists in early detection but also in effectively describing the damage when filing a roof leak insurance claim.


​The Basics of Roof Leak Insurance Claims

​
​Navigating the process of a roof leak insurance claim can feel daunting. Initially, homeowners must understand their policy coverage limits, deductibles, and any specific exclusions related to roof leaks. Policies vary significantly, and what is covered under one may be excluded under another. For instance, damage from a sudden event like a hurricane is often covered, whereas gradual damage due to neglect may not be. It's essential to review your insurance policy before disaster strikes, so you are aware of your coverage scope and how to proceed with a claim.

​Filing a Successful Roof Leak Insurance Claim

​
​The key to filing a successful roof leak insurance claim in Florida lies in the details and documentation. From the moment you notice a leak, it's critical to document everything: take photos of the damage, maintain records of repairs, and keep a log of conversations with your insurance company. Hiring a professional to assess the damage can provide an unbiased estimate, crucial for negotiations with insurance adjusters. Remember, insurance companies aim to minimize their payouts; equipped with thorough documentation, homeowners stand a stronger chance of receiving a fair settlement.
Following the submission of your claim, an adjuster from your insurance company will likely inspect the damage. This is where detailed documentation and possibly a third-party assessment can support your case. Be prepared to negotiate and, if necessary, advocate for the full extent of your damages to be covered. Patience and perseverance are key, as the claims process can be lengthy and complex.

​Common Challenges in Roof Leak Claims

​
​One of the most significant hurdles homeowners face when filing roof leak insurance claims is the insurance company's dispute over the cause of damage. Insurers may argue the damage was pre-existing or due to lack of maintenance rather than a covered peril. Furthermore, the age of your roof can play a critical role in how much, if anything, your policy will cover. Policies now days have matching endorsements and also will depreciate the value of older roofs, potentially leaving homeowners to shoulder a major portion of the repair costs.
